Tony Gilham and Thorney Motorsports have announced that they are teaming up for the Snetterton round of the Dunlop MSA British Touring Car Championship this weekend. The Team HARD owner and former Porsche Carrera Cup GB driver will take the helm of the Vauxhall Insignia NGTC car, reuniting him with the Griffin for the first time since Snetterton 2011 when he last raced for 888 Racing with Colins Contractors. Chevrolet and Ray Mallock Limited, (RML) have confirmed that they will not contest the 2012 Dunlop British Touring Car Championship, choosing to focus on their WTCC defence instead. The move leaves GoMobileUK.com With Techspeed as the sole Chevrolet presence in the UK tintop series now ES Racing have switched to Vectras.
Jason Plato has left the Silverline Chevrolet team for a new role at MG. The MG KX Momentum Racing team will campaign two MG6 GT touring cars built to NGTC spec in 2012. The effort is not as laughable as it initially appears either.
